Ehrmantraut named female athlete of the week
It didn't take long for the first 30-point night in MCAC women's basketball.
Who else, but the reigning player of the year? Briana Ehrmantraut followed an 11-point, seven-rebound opener with 30 points, four rebounds and three steals as the Canadian Mennonite University Blazers started the season with two wins over the Université de Saint-Boniface Les Rouges.
Ehrmantraut is the MCAC female athlete of the week.
"Briana had an excellent showing against USB and that put an indelible mark on CMU's promising season this year. Her consistency and tenacity in CMU's second game against USB was one of the key factors in CMU's
victory in an otherwise very tight rematch, and a direct reflection of the
endless hours she puts in the gym to hone her game," said coach Sharlene Harding.
The Blazers are off this weekend while Les Rouges host the Providence University College Pilots on Friday and visit them on Saturday.
